Apple has announced that two more international store openings will occur alongside the Burlington, Ontario launch happening this Saturday. In Germany the company is unveiling an Augsburg outlet, located within the City-Galerie. The opening will mark just the sixth for the country, which has still to see an Apple Store in the capital of Berlin, though plans are underway.
Italy is getting a new store in the Marcianise area, based within the Campania commercial center. The launch will put the country one shop ahead of Germany, although Augsburg will represent the 100th Apple Store to premiere outside of the US. Apple now has less than a dozen stores to debut by the end of September to meet a self-imposed deadline.
